The University of Wisconsin-Madison has contributed back the extensive
changes we have added to the Courses Portlet.
I do say extensive because the commit includes 153 changed files with
8,335 additions and 714 deletions.

We apologize for the "pig through the python" approach.

We have did update the model.
We did our best to insure the changes work with the existing code.
We have included mock data for the changes we've made
so you can run the code "out-of-the-box", in uPortal.

I think most interest has been peaked by the Class Schedule Grid
which relies heavily on the jquery.timetable.js project.
